Lori Barrett
OWNER
Lori Barrett is an FEI rider and trainer specialising in the development of young dressage prospects. Before retiring to focus on her own horses, she followed Olympian Heather Blitz as Head Trainer for Oak Hill Ranch, head of the Danish Studbook in the US, as well as having been the Head Trainer at the Chesapeake Dressage Institute. Previously Assistant Trainer to Olympian Tina Konyot, Lori got her professional start in dressage working as assistant for 2 years in Germany under Grand Prix trainer Carla Symader before returning to the US to finish her Master's degree in Education.
Lori's most recent coaches include Sabine Schut-Kery and Olympic Chef d’Equipe Anne Gribbons.
